Maximize for Visibility: Google Play Keyword Research and ASO

Achieving stellar visibility on the Google Play Store is crucial for app success. A well-executed App Store Optimization (ASO) strategy can significantly influence your app's discoverability, driving organic downloads and boosting user engagement. At its core, ASO revolves around exploiting relevant keywords that users search for when looking for apps like yours. By conducting thorough keyword research and strategically incorporating those keywords into your app's metadata, you can enhance your chances of appearing in top search results.

Google Play Keyword Research tools offer a wealth of data to help you identify the most relevant keywords within your app's category. Analyze competitor apps, explore related terms, and consider user search behavior to compile a comprehensive list of potential keywords.

  • Incorporate these keywords strategically within your app title, description, short description, and even in your app's genres.
  • Adjust your metadata regularly to reflect changes in user search trends and market demands.
  • Monitor your ASO performance using Google Play Console analytics to gauge the effectiveness of your keyword strategy and make data-driven adjustments.

By consistently refining your keyword research and ASO efforts, you can significantly boost your app's visibility on the Google Play Store, leading to increased downloads, user engagement, and ultimately, app success.
